検索
2012年4月15日日曜日
のんびりruby
コマンドライン引数を受け取る。
コマンドライン引数はARGVに入ってくる。
1番目の引数が、ARGV[0]に、2番目がARGV[1]に、順次入っていく。
スクリプト
--------------------------------------------------
puts ARGV[0]
puts ARGV[1]
--------------------------------------------------
実行結果
--------------------------------------------------
>test.rb hello world
hello
world
--------------------------------------------------
よし、頑張った。
2012年4月11日水曜日
のんびりruby
少しずつでもrubyの勉強をしていこうと思います。
まずは定番の出力系コマンドから。
スクリプト
--------------------------------------------------
puts "hello"
print "hello"
print "hello\n"
print("hello\n")
p "hello"
--------------------------------------------------
実行結果
--------------------------------------------------
hello
hellohello
hello
"hello"
--------------------------------------------------
よし、頑張った。
まずは定番の出力系コマンドから。
スクリプト
--------------------------------------------------
puts "hello"
print "hello"
print "hello\n"
print("hello\n")
p "hello"
--------------------------------------------------
実行結果
--------------------------------------------------
hello
hellohello
hello
"hello"
--------------------------------------------------
よし、頑張った。
2011年7月24日日曜日
EXIFrで写真のEXIFを取得
ちょっと前にデジカメを買いました。
風景や鳥や花を撮影しています。
EXIFデータを取得するスクリプトを書いてみようと思い、
ネットから情報を探してみました。
rubyのライブラリはいくつかあるようですが、
その中でも簡単そうなEXIFrを使ってみることにしました。
EXIF Reader
まずはgem installでexifrをインストール。
コードを書いてみます
--------------------------------------
require 'rubygems'
require 'exifr'
fname = ARGV[0]
puts EXIFR::JPEG::new(fname).date_time
---------------------------------------
実行結果は
---------------------------------------
>exif.rb test.jpg
Tue Jul 17 15:09:44 +0900 2011
---------------------------------------
結果が帰ってきました。
工夫すれば写真の整理等に使えそうです。
風景や鳥や花を撮影しています。
EXIFデータを取得するスクリプトを書いてみようと思い、
ネットから情報を探してみました。
rubyのライブラリはいくつかあるようですが、
その中でも簡単そうなEXIFrを使ってみることにしました。
EXIF Reader
まずはgem installでexifrをインストール。
コードを書いてみます
--------------------------------------
require 'rubygems'
require 'exifr'
fname = ARGV[0]
puts EXIFR::JPEG::new(fname).date_time
---------------------------------------
実行結果は
---------------------------------------
>exif.rb test.jpg
Tue Jul 17 15:09:44 +0900 2011
---------------------------------------
結果が帰ってきました。
工夫すれば写真の整理等に使えそうです。
登録:
投稿 (Atom)